Pasta with Asparagus, Goat Cheese, and Lemon

This quick and easy pasta dish with asparagus, goat cheese, and lemon takes only about 15 minutes to make and is a perfect dinner option after a long day at work.

Preparation Time
10 mins
Cooking Time
20 mins
Total Time
30 mins
Calories
688 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ook spaghetti in the boiling water, stirring occasionally, for 9 minutes. Add asparagus to the pot. Continue cooking until spaghetti is tender yet firm to the bite, about 3 minutes. Drain spaghetti and asparagus, reserving some cooking water.
Step 2
Combine goat cheese, olive oil, basil, and lemon zest in a large bowl. Add hot spaghetti, asparagus, and 2 tablespoons of cooking water; mix well. Season with l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Serve with Parmesan cheese sprinkled on top.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• salt and ground black pepper to taste
  • 1 (8 ounce) package spaghetti
  • 2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ese, or to taste
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h basil, or more to taste
  • 2 ounces chevre (soft goat cheese), crumbled
  • 0.5 lemon, zested and juiced
  • 0.5 pound asparagus, cut into bite-sized pieces
